The Meadows at Hugo Sketch Plan <br /> Shayla Denaway, Parks Planner,reviewed the sketch plan from Golden Valley Land Company for"The <br /> Meadows at Hugo'. The sketch plan is for 84 residential lots on 33.41 acres located north of 159th Street and <br /> West of Highway 61. The developer is not proposing to dedicate land and the fee would be$201,600. The <br /> developer proposed that the City build a street on the adjacent city-owned property to provide access the <br /> development. <br /> The Parks Commission discussed that Frog Hollow would serve the park needs of the neighborhood. They <br /> also discussed that a future park could go on either city owned property or be built with future development <br /> to the north. The Commission generally agreed that payment of a park dedication fee was preferred over <br /> dedication of land and trying to locate a small park in this development.
